L'Oreal Malaysia's Management Trainee Program is designed to provide a comprehensive training and development experience for new graduates or young professionals. The program involves rotations across different departments and functions within the company, including marketing, sales, finance, supply chain, and human resources. Throughout the program, trainees receive guidance and mentorship from senior leaders and are given the opportunity to work on real projects and initiatives. They also participate in training sessions and workshops to enhance their knowledge and skills in areas such as leadership, communication, and business acumen. Overall, the Management Trainee Program at L'Oreal Malaysia aims to equip participants with a strong foundation in business management and prepare them for future leadership roles within the company.

As a management trainee at L'Oreal Malaysia, you will have the opportunity to gain hands-on experience in various functions and departments within the company. Upon completion of the program, you may be offered a permanent position within L'Oreal Malaysia, typically in a managerial or specialist role. With dedication and strong performance, you may have the potential to progress further in your career within the company and take on more senior leadership roles.
